A Heroic Better Angel

The movie is based on an article by journalist Tom Junod, “Can You Say Hero?“, which is itself beautiful. It is a true story of a real-life friendship between Fred Rogers and Junod. The star of the movie is Matthew Rhys, who plays Junod.

“A Beautiful Day in the Neighborhood”, via Hanks-Rhys interplay, lays out the what, why, and how of Mr. Rodgers’ life work.

Sample practices of Mr. Rodgers as shared in the movie:

  • Primarily,  Mr. Rodgers works to “give children positive ways to deal with anger and feelings”.  He makes the child in front of him realize he is special and important.
  • Mr. Rogers tells Lloyd that his pained relationship with his father has shaped who he is today. In the end, Mr. Rogers tells a grieving family that death is part of being human.
  • The movie shows the humanness of Mr. Rodgers, depicting how he deals with the burden of his fans telling him their problems all day.
